Наступна вакансія

Середній Ява інженер в NerdySoft

Розміщено більше 30 днів тому

170 переглядів

NerdySoft

NerdySoft

0
0 відгуків
Без досвіду
Львів

Перекладено Google

19 липня 2024 Middle Java Engineer Львів, за кордоном NerdySoft у пошуках талановитого та проактивного Middle Java- інженера, який разом з нашою командою розроблятиме проєкт із розробки повноцінного банківського рішення! Вимоги: — 3-4+ років комерційного досвіду з Java; — Досвід роботи зі Spring (Spring Boot/Spring MVC), Spring Data, Hibernate; — Ґрунтовне знання проєктування та реалізації веб-сервісів REST; — Розуміння принципів OOP/OOD, досвід з патернами проєктування та архітектур

19 липня 2024

Middle Java Engineer

Львів, за кордоном

NerdySoft у пошуках талановитого та проактивного Middle Java- інженера, який разом з нашою командою розроблятиме проєкт із розробки повноцінного банківського рішення!

Вимоги:

— 3-4+ років комерційного досвіду з Java;
— Досвід роботи зі Spring (Spring Boot/Spring MVC), Spring Data, Hibernate;
— Ґрунтовне знання проєктування та реалізації веб-сервісів REST;
— Розуміння принципів OOP/OOD, досвід з патернами проєктування та архітектурними патернами;
— Комерційний досвід роботи з мікросервісами, Distributed Transactions, SAGA, CAP.
— Знання SQL і PostgreSQL;
— Розуміння принципів проєктування бази даних;
— Досвід роботи з NoSQL базами даних;
— Досвід роботи з Docker/Kubernetes;
— Досвід написання модульних та інтеграційних тестів;
— Досвід роботи з RabbitMQ;
— Досвід роботи з ElasticSearch;
— Рівень англійської — B2 і вище.

Буде перевагою:

— Ступінь бакалавра або магістра в галузі комп’ютерних наук;
— Досвід роботи з проектами у банківській сфері;
— Розуміння модульного тестування як частини циклу розробки програмного забезпечення, відстежування керованої розробки в межах команди.

Обов’язки:

— Дизайн і розробка АРІ;
— Інтеграція з третіми сторонами (провайдерами платіжних послуг, платформами обміну повідомленнями, сервісами для аналітики чи безпеки тощо);
— Написання багаторазового, тестованого та ефективного коду;
— Пряме спілкування та співпраця з клієнтом;
— Написання модульних та інтеграційних тестів;
— Розробка нового функціоналу;
— Робота з вимогами бізнесу;
— Проєктування та розробка нових сервісів/модулів;
— Дизайн баз даних;
— Проведення рев’ю коду;
— Демо-презентація;
— Відповідальність за випуски;
— Масштабування системи.

Ми пропонуємо:

— Довготривалу та плідну співпрацю;
— Гнучкий графік роботи та можливість працювати віддалено;
— Комфортний, сучасний офіс у центрі Львова, що обладнаний генератором та старлінком;
— Регулярний перегляд компенсації за результатами співпраці;
— 18 робочих днів щорічної оплачуваної відпустки(+2 додаткові дні за лояльність до компанії) та 25 оплачуваних лікарняних;
— Медичне страхування або компенсація витрат на спортивні активності;
— 50% компенсації за сертифікації, конференції, тренінги та інше професійне навчання;
— 50% компенсації за курси англійської мови;
— Регулярне проведення корпоративних івентів;
— Мінімум бюрократії та мікроменеджменту, прості та зрозумілі процеси та поза тим чудова культура компанії та цінності, які ми прагнемо розділити з вами!

Про проєкт:

Для групи банків, розташованих у різних країнах, ми розроблятимемо Core Banking System — комплекс програмних і технічних рішень, які спрямовані на автоматизацію банківської діяльності. Працюватимемо над модулями, що відповідають за рахунки та роботу з ними, проведення транзакцій і рух коштів, прорахунок та процесинг депозитів, кредитів, звітностей тощо.

Проєкт довготривалий. Тех.стек: Java 17, Spring, Hibernate, SQL, Docker.

NerdySoft команда: 1 DM, 1 PC, 3 BA, 2 Designers, 2 DevOps, 5 FE devs (React), 8 BE devs (Java), 5 QA, 2 Technical Writers.

Перекладено Google

Без досвіду
Львів
Хочете знайти підходящу роботу?
Нові вакансії у вашому Telegram
Підписатись
Ми використовуємо cookies
Прийняти